Salt Spring
Salt Spring is a spring in Tuolumne County, Gold Country, California and has an elevation of 7,520 feet. Salt Spring is situated nearby to the hamlet Dardanelle.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Dardanelle.
Dardanelle
Hamlet
Dardanelle is an unincorporated community in the Stanislaus National Forest in Tuolumne County, California, United States. It is located on California State Route 108 39 miles northeast of Sonora. Dardanelle is situated 3 miles north of Salt Spring.
